TRPA1 抗体

(Transient Receptor Potential Cation Channel, Subfamily A, Member 1 (TRPA1))
The structure of the protein encoded by this gene is highly related to both the protein ankyrin and transmembrane proteins. The specific function of this protein has not yet been determined\; however, studies indicate the function may involve a role in signal transduction and growth control. [provided by RefSeq, Jul 2008].
